<p>The fact is that many individuals arrive at the senior level with much still to learn about people. Often they bring to the executive wing styles, habits and beliefs that have worked for them since they were a supervisor. Suddenly these formula for success no longer work and, in many cases, must be unlearned and replaced with behaviors more in line with modern leadership.</p>
<p>This is why so many organizations today are investing in coaching for their key leaders. The benefits from being coached stem primarily from the leverage that is obtained. When a senior leader operates with a less-than functional style, its negative impact on performance and morale can reverberate from within the senior leadership team right out through the frontlines to the customer. The good news is that turning this individual&#8217;s style around will have the same multiplier effect in a positive direction.</p>
<p><strong>What is Coaching?</strong></p>
<p>Coaching is a series of periodic one-on-one consultations, usually with an external resource, over a period of time-typically anywhere from three to eighteen months. Between sessions the &#8220;coachee&#8221; (whom we will call the &#8220;client&#8221;) applies newly learned approaches at work, receives feedback, then reassesses, and refines his/her behavior accordingly. Coaching is not therapy, however, occasionally a coach may suggest counseling as a promising course of action for deeper seated issues that are blocking effectiveness. Well done coaching yields a high return on investment because the process is totally customized to the &#8220;client&#8217;s&#8221; challenges and needs and it maximizes the executive&#8217;s time off the job.</p>
<p><em>The goal of the coaching process is to generate, in the client, effective skills and attitudes that are self-sustaining, self-correcting and directly supportive of his or her expected performance results.</em></p>

<p>In principle, selling your coaching service to an executive is no different than selling it to any other person. However, there are some points that can make a lot of difference in the result, and you would better adapt your sale routine accordingly.</p>
<p>So first, what are the principles of sale?</p>
<p>a. Get close to your prospective client. Make introduction, build some conversation, a little trust.</p>
<p>b. Find out what is the prospective client&#8217;s challenge or problem, so that you can show him why your coaching service is the answer.</p>
<p>c. Sell benefits, not features.</p>
<p>d. Identify and overcome objections</p>
<p>c. Close the deal</p>
